Waikanae Community Board by-election 2020

Following a second resignation from the Waikanae Community Board, the Kāpiti Coast District Council has called for a by-election to fill the vacant seats. Community Boards are an important part of local democracy and we encourage anyone who has an interest in representing the interests of, and advocating on behalf of, the Waikanae community to get in touch with the Council.

Final results | Name and address list for candidates | Candidates' profiles | Voter information 

Final results

Preliminary results in the Waikanae Community Board by-election 2020 have been announced after voting closed at noon today (16 December 2020).

New board members will be inaugurated in the New Year.

See the final results, [PDF 71 KB] iteration report [XLSX 11 KB] and expense returns [PDF 5.04 MB].

The new Waikanae Community Board members are:

  • Richard Mansell
  • Tonchi Begovich

 Timeline:

    • Tues 22 Sept
      Candidate nominations open
    • Tues 20 Oct 2020
      Candidate nominations close 12 midday
    • Mon 23 to Thurs 26 Nov 2020
      Delivery of voting documents
    • Mon 23 Nov to Wed 16 Dec 2020
      Voting papers returned to electoral officer (via post, or official drop-box/ collection point)
    • Wed 16 Dec 2020: Election Day
      Voting closes 12 midday
